You're Going to Love Punta Gorda

With a population of 16,641, Punta Gorda is a must-see destination in Florida, United States. It is among the most popular tourist destinations in the country. We recommend you stay at least 3 days in order to fully appreciate everything Punta Gorda has to offer.

Looking for warm weather? Then head to Punta Gorda in July, when the average temperature is 82.4 °F, and the highest can go up to 91.4 °F. The coldest month, on the other hand, is January, when it can get as cold as 53.6 °F, with an average temperature of 64.4 °F. You’re likely to see more rain in September, when precipitation is around 8.5″. In contrast, November is usually the driest month of the year in Punta Gorda, with an average rainfall of 1.5″.

How to Get to Punta Gorda

Plane

When flying to Punta Gorda, you’ll arrive at Punta Gorda (PGD), which is located 3 miles from the city center. The shortest domestic flight to Punta Gorda departs from Chicago and takes around 2h 45m.

Car

Another option to get to Punta Gorda is to pick up a car rental from Orlando, which is about 118 miles from Punta Gorda. You’ll find branches of Rent-A-Wreck and Routes Car & Truck Rentals, among others, in Orlando.

Where to stay in Punta Gorda

If you’re on a budget, well-reviewed accommodations include Holiday Inn Express & Suites Punta Gorda By IHG and Baymont by Wyndham Punta Gorda Port Charlotte. There are also lots of vacation rental options in Punta Gorda, with prices from $70 to $833 per night. Charlotte Park is the neighborhood with the highest amount of rentals to choose from. On average, vacation rentals in Punta Gorda are about 6% cheaper than a hotel room in the city.

Renting a car in Punta Gorda

Renting a car in Punta Gorda costs $47 per day, on average, or $141 if you want to rent if for 3 days. Alamo, Budget and Hertz are the agencies with the best reviews in the city. The most popular location to rent a car in Punta Gorda is the Budget branch at 28000 Airport Road, Unit A8, which is 3 miles from the city center.

It’s generally cheaper to rent your vehicle outside the airport: locations in the city are around 17% cheaper than airport locations in Punta Gorda.

Expect to pay $4.09 per gallon in Punta Gorda (average price from the past 30 days). Depending on the size of your rental car, filling up the tank will cost between $49.06 and $65.41. The most frequently booked car type in Punta Gorda is Intermediate (Ford Escape or similar). If you’re looking to save money, though, keep in mind that Full-size rental cars (Toyota Camry or similar) are, on average, 52% cheaper than other rental car types in the city.
